GS B
Function: Turn white/black reverse printing mode on/off
Code ASCII:
GS B n
Code HEX: 0x1D 0x42 n
Range:
0 ≤ n ≤ 255
Default:
n = 0
Description: Turns white/black reverse printing mode on or off.
• When the LSB of n is 0, white/black reverse printing mode is turned off.
• When the LSB of n is 1, white/black reverse printing mode is turned on.
Notes:
• The white/black reverse printing mode is effective for all characters
(except for HRI characters).
• When white/black reverse printing mode is turned on, it also affects the
right-side character spacing set by ESC SP.
• When white/black reverse printing mode is turned on, it does not affect
the space between lines.
• When underline mode is turned on, the printer does not underline
white/black reverse characters.
• This command is effective until ESC @ is executed, the printer is reset, or
the power is turned off.
• In white/black reverse printing mode, characters are printed in white on a
black background.
